1. A lighting emitting diode (LED) illumination system that operates in a boost mode and a bypass mode, comprising:

  • a plurality of LEDs that are coupled in series to form a LED string;

    a plurality of bypass elements, each coupled in parallel with a respective group of one or more of the LEDs and configured to bypass selectively the respective group of LEDs in the bypass mode;

    a boost converter, coupled to the plurality of LEDs, that is configured to generate a drive voltage to drive the plurality of LEDs, wherein the boost converter includes a boost controller that is configured to enable the boost mode in response to a boost enable signal; and

    a first current sink and a second current sink, coupled to the plurality of LEDs, that are configured to provide two drive currents to drive the LEDs in the boost mode and the bypass mode, respectively;

    wherein in the boost mode the boost controller is electrically coupled to control the boost converter to drive the LED string by a boosted drive voltage, and in the bypass mode the boost controller is deactivated to allow the boost converter to drive a subset of the plurality of LEDs by a regular drive voltage that is substantially lower than the boosted drive voltage.
